NRG Energy 's NRG strategic focus on reducing emissions significantly strengthens its long-term investment outlook. By aligning its operations with global decarbonization efforts and tightening environmental regulations, the company is well-positioned to capitalize on policy incentives, improve stakeholder confidence and reduce regulatory risks. Its commitment to achieving net-zero emissions by 2050, supported by interim 2030 targets, reflects a well-defined and credible sustainability roadmap.
NRG Energy's planned shift toward a lower-carbon business model is not only environmentally responsible but financially advantageous. The company's investments in clean technologies, like battery storage, carbon capture and demand-side energy management, are enhancing operational efficiency, improving profit margins and increasing grid reliability. As carbon pricing becomes more common, NRG Energy's cleaner portfolio offers a significant cost advantage by avoiding the financial penalties imposed on high-emission operators.
Receding emissions levels strengthen NRG's brand equity and deepen customer loyalty in a market increasingly driven by sustainability preferences. With a vast retail electricity platform serving millions of residential and commercial clients, NRG Energy is well-positioned to deliver cleaner, more personalized energy solutions. The company's green product offerings and energy efficiency services also unlock new cross-selling opportunities and recurring revenue streams.
In summary, NRG Energy's decarbonization efforts place it in a favorable position amid the clean energy transition. By proactively pursuing net-zero goals, the company is mitigating long-term risks while tapping into the expanding opportunities of a low-carbon economy.
How Utilities Are Reducing Emission Levels?
Utilities across the United States are reducing emissions by transitioning to cleaner energy sources, modernizing infrastructure and investing in emerging technologies. Companies are implementing carbon capture systems to meet climate goals.
Duke Energy Corporation DUK is targeting to achieve net-zero emissions by 2050. To achieve its target, Duke Energy will shut all coal units and invest in clean energy assets.
Xcel Energy XEL is undertaking initiatives to produce and deliver clean energy to customers. The company aims to serve all customers with 100% zero-carbon emissions by 2050. Xcel will invest in emerging new technologies and increase the efficiency of existing units.

PHOENIX (AP) — Arizona Gov. Katie Hobbs signed legislation Friday that funds up to $500 million in renovations to Chase Field, home of the Arizona Diamondbacks. Article content The bill, which won bipartisan support in both of the state's GOP-controlled chambers, will use sales tax revenue from the stadium and nearby buildings for infrastructure upgrades over the next 30 years, including improvements to air conditioning systems and the stadium's retractable roof. Article content Article content Article content The team said it will also contribute $250 million for the renovations at the stadium, which is located in downtown Phoenix and is surrounded by small businesses and restaurants that see a boost of activity during the baseball season. Article content The legislation is one of a handful of bipartisan deals that Hobbs, a Democrat, prioritized negotiating during the session. She says the funding is a responsible use of taxpayer dollars, will provide good-paying jobs and ensure the Diamondbacks do not leave Phoenix. Article content Attendance at games has increased since the team's 2023 run to the World Series, where the Diamondbacks lost to the Texas Rangers. This season they are averaging 31,420 fans per game — the highest in two decades. Article content 'I'm not going to let Arizona lose the Diamondbacks,' Hobbs said Friday on the social platform X. Article content Derrick Hall, president and CEO of the Diamondbacks, praised the governor and said the team will now turn its attention to extending its lease with Maricopa County. Article content Article content The bill cleared the Legislature June 23 after months of debate that included the question of whether the Diamondbacks could potentially leave unless a public funding deal was reached. Article content Other MLB teams have threatened to leave host cities if they did not get public financing. Article content The Oakland A's, for example, complained for years about the Oakland Coliseum and an inability to gain government assistance for a new ballpark. Now the team is bound for Las Vegas, where a groundbreaking ceremony was held this month for a $1.75 billion ballpark that is expected to be completed in time for the 2028 season. Nevada and Clark County approved up to $380 million in public funds for the project. Article content And last year voters in Jackson County, Missouri, rejected an attempt to extend a sales tax that would have helped fund a ballpark for the Kansas City Royals and stadium renovations for the Kansas City Chiefs. Lawmakers in Kansas are trying to lure the teams with government subsidies, and Missouri is trying to keep them with its own financial incentives.
